- A pooled analysis of three clinical trials identified higher serum TRACP-5b levels and lower Bristol Stool Form Scale scores as independent predictors of requiring higher tenapanor doses in dialysis patients with hyperphosphatemia. - Elevated TRACP-5b, a marker of bone resorption, suggests that greater bone-derived phosphorus release may attenuate tenapanor's phosphorus-lowering effect, necessitating dose escalation. - Patients prone to constipation were more likely to tolerate higher tenapanor doses, likely due to the drug's osmotic, stool-softening mechanism of action. - The findings support incorporating bone turnover and bowel habit assessments into routine clinical evaluation to guide individualized tenapanor dosing.
- Kura Oncology has dosed first patients in KOMET-015, a Phase 1 trial evaluating ziftomenib in combination with imatinib for advanced gastrointestinal stromal tumors (GIST) after imatinib failure. - Preclinical studies show the combination provides robust antitumor activity in both imatinib-sensitive and imatinib-resistant GIST models through a synthetic lethal mechanism targeting tumor vulnerabilities. - With approximately 60% of GIST patients developing imatinib resistance within two years, this novel menin inhibitor combination represents a potential breakthrough for the estimated 4,000-6,000 new GIST cases diagnosed annually in the U.S.
- AstraZeneca's Fasenra (benralizumab) has been approved in the EU for adult patients with relapsing or refractory eosinophilic granulomatosis with polyangiitis (EGPA). - The approval was based on the Phase III MANDARA trial, which demonstrated comparable remission rates between Fasenra and mepolizumab. - Data from the MANDARA trial also showed that 41% of Fasenra-treated patients were able to fully taper off oral corticosteroids (OCS). - Fasenra offers a convenient, single-monthly injection, providing a much-needed treatment option for EGPA patients in Europe.
